143 Deputy Michael McGrath asked the Minister for Finance the steps that have been taken to implement the recommendation in the inter-departmental mortgage arrears working group, known as the Keane report, to establish an independent mortgage advice function; if he will confirm if the process of recruiting the 100 independent mortgage advisers has commenced; when he hopes to have the service up and running;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[11349/12]
